The Summer Stamp SAL has come to an end. 

All of the stamps are stitched, and the big sampler is in its frame.

 Goodness, I have  had a great time these last few weeks sharing the summer stamps.

 I want to thank everyone who dropped in for the sweet visits and for cheering me on. I also want to thank those who have stitched along with me. I hope  these little stamps brought a bit of joy to your day. 

I stitched the Summer Stamps twice . The large sampler was stitched on 14 count Rit yellow dyed Aida. 

If you are interested in how I dyed my 14 count Aida, I shared the process in a previous post entitled Let's Dye Some Fabric.

I framed the sampler in a thrifted frame temporarily until I find a frame that I really like. 


I then stitched the Summer Stamps into little pin pillows on 14 count coffee/ tea dyed Aida.


🌞Time to Dye-  2024 post on how I tea/ Coffee Dye my fabric. 



The trim around each pillow is two strands of chenille yarn that is twisted and tacked to the seams of the pillow.
